Friedländer's second communication on the micrococci of pneumonia, which appeared on 15 November 1883, touched off a controversy over the causative agent of pneumonia that continued for the next three years. In this second report he noted that he had examined more than 50 additional cases of pneumonia and that he had identified bacteria in nearly all of them and that sections from which the bacteria were absent were from the lungs of patients dying late in the course of the disease. Friedländer also noted that it was necessary to use special stains (e.g. the Gram Stain) to see the bacteria because using ordinary stains (H&E) nuclei and fibrin stained the same way as bacteria and thus obscured the ability to see the bacteria. As a result, ''Klebsiella pneumoniae'' is often called ''Friedländer's bacterium'' or ''Friedländer's bacillus''.

In 1886, he introduced the
ampoule
An ampoule (also ampul and ampule) is a small sealed vial which is used to contain and preserve a sample, usually a solid or liquid. Ampoules are usually made of glass.
Modern ampoules are most commonly used to contain pharmaceuticals and chem ...
in medicine.
He died a premature death, aged 39 or 40, after a brief stint with a respiratory disease, believed to be caused by his discovered infectious organism, the
Friedlander's Bacillus.
